"If you have played any of the previous LEGO branded 3D platformers then you know what to expect here: Lush recreations of the movies where all of the people and vehicles, and anything else you can interact with, have been replaced by LEGO bricks and mini figures. You take control of the charming little plastic caricatures of the protagonists, swapping between them as required and then run through the six most important scenes in each film, blowing up as much of the scenery as possible as you do so."
